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Support suyu emulator #50

Open
SRC267 opened this issue Mar 8, 2024 · 15 comments
Open

Support suyu emulator #50

SRC267 opened this issue Mar 8, 2024 · 15 comments
Labels
documentation Improvements or additions to documentation enhancement New feature or request

Comments

@SRC267
Copy link

SRC267 commented Mar 8, 2024

With yuzu gone, could this project be migrated to support suyu?

It's still early days so there's potential.

@amakvana amakvana added documentation Improvements or additions to documentation enhancement New feature or request labels Mar 8, 2024
@amakvana
Copy link
Owner

amakvana commented Mar 8, 2024

This is something I am considering. However, I'm waiting for some development on the potential forks before committing to anything.

@Redhawk18
Copy link

I've been helping with Suyu and it's just not ready yet. Just external work like making a website, and reconnecting all the 3rd party library modules Yuzu created has been very challenging. It took days for us to be able to build the emulator

@amakvana
Copy link
Owner

amakvana commented Mar 11, 2024

Totally understand! I can imagine there being a lot of work to do on it. I've seen the Git and the commits being made - so good effort so far!

Once there is some significant progress. E.g. under the hood improvements and a public build released. I will consider updating EzYuzu, rebranding it and pointing it towards Suyu.

I don't want to be in a position whereby I spend my time rewriting code to make it work for the latest fork, only for that fork to be abandoned and for me to be back in the same position as before. Hence I am happy to wait for further progression.

@Redhawk18
Copy link

thank you, we need an installer. But first we need to stabilize everything first.

@Redhawk18
Copy link

does this work on linux and mac?

@amakvana
Copy link
Owner

does this work on linux and mac?

The currently released version of EzYuzu doesn't at the moment.

I was part way through rewriting it to support Linux and Mac, but the takedown happened. So development is paused.

Once further progress of Suyu has been made, I'll continue the rewrite, enabling Linux and Mac support

@LegzRwheelz
Copy link

@amakvana hey, I love your tool,I requested you to add CLI for updating and you made it to where I could create a Windows task and it worked flawlessly. I love it so much that it inspired me to make my own little updater tool for xemu as a proof of concept. My skills are rather limited though. Anyhow, onto the reason for my commenting here. I've been talking to one of the SuYu devs and they're trying to find the best way to keep SuYu up-to-date so I suggested them going about it in the same way your perfect little tool then i got the idea that their team would benefit big-time if you were to join their team. If your tool were to be directly baked into the new emu, it would be perfect! Just a suggestion

@amakvana
Copy link
Owner

@amakvana hey, I love your tool,I requested you to add CLI for updating and you made it to where I could create a Windows task and it worked flawlessly. I love it so much that it inspired me to make my own little updater tool for xemu as a proof of concept. My skills are rather limited though. Anyhow, onto the reason for my commenting here. I've been talking to one of the SuYu devs and they're trying to find the best way to keep SuYu up-to-date so I suggested them going about it in the same way your perfect little tool then i got the idea that their team would benefit big-time if you were to join their team. If your tool were to be directly baked into the new emu, it would be perfect! Just a suggestion

I could be open to this.

To be fair, getting EzYuzu to work for Suyu wouldn't take too much work to do.

I'd want to see a public release made first, with some under-the-hood improvements to show the devs are committed to working on it

@LegzRwheelz
Copy link

@amakvana hey, I love your tool,I requested you to add CLI for updating and you made it to where I could create a Windows task and it worked flawlessly. I love it so much that it inspired me to make my own little updater tool for xemu as a proof of concept. My skills are rather limited though. Anyhow, onto the reason for my commenting here. I've been talking to one of the SuYu devs and they're trying to find the best way to keep SuYu up-to-date so I suggested them going about it in the same way your perfect little tool then i got the idea that their team would benefit big-time if you were to join their team. If your tool were to be directly baked into the new emu, it would be perfect! Just a suggestion

I could be open to this.

To be fair, getting EzYuzu to work for Suyu wouldn't take too much work to do.

I'd want to see a public release made first, with some under-the-hood improvements to show the devs are committed to working on it

I totally get that, I was thinking of compiling my own and trying to implement your source code into the emu to see if it can even be done, this would be my own private thing, ofc. I don't have the skills or confidence try to join a major dev team, as much as I would like to, I just don't think I could bring what you bring to the table.

@Hrodgaer
Copy link

A public beta (0.0.2) is now available in its Gitlab since yesterday. I imagine that they will publish their next public releases there.

@amakvana
Copy link
Owner

I saw the releases yesterday on their page using the link below:

https://gitlab.com/suyu-emu/suyu/

Now when I browse it, it returns a 404 error. Not sure where the repo has gone, along with the 20k+ commits made.

Also the Download button on the Suyu Website is broken

@SRC267
Copy link
Author

SRC267 commented Mar 21, 2024

I saw that they are offline due to a DMCA takedown link

@LegzRwheelz
Copy link

here is the releases page

@Hrodgaer
Copy link

https://git.suyu.dev/suyu/suyu/releases

@amakvana
Copy link
Owner

Considering the DMCA takedown, etc. I'm going to wait a little for things to calm down and then continue working on switching over to Suyu.

I will resume development and the rewrite in the meantime

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
documentation Improvements or additions to documentation en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

5 participants